We’ve just released JupyterHub 0.8 to PyPI. Tagged Docker images and
conda-forge should propagate shortly.

This is a big one with lots of fixes and exciting improvements. See the blog
post <https://blog.jupyter.org/jupyterhub-0-8-19b00b75e3df> for an overview
and the changelog
<https://jupyterhub.readthedocs.io/en/0.8.0/changelog.html> for more
details.

You can upgrade with:

pip install jupyterhub==0.8.0

There are significant changes to internal communication between the Hub and
single-user servers, so it is important when you upgrade JupyterHub to
upgrade the version inside your user environments as well. This means
adding a line like

pip install jupyterhub==0.8.0

to your Dockerfiles if you are using a container-based deployment to ensure
that the Hub and single-user servers have the same version.
